Lynn vs. Polk State
Both Lynn University and Polk State College are 4 years schools located in Florida. The following statements compare Lynn University and Polk State College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Lynn's tuition ($42,950) is more expensive than Polk State ($12,271).

-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,120.
- Lynn's students to faculty ratio (16 to 1) is lower than Polk State (20 to 1).
- Polk State (7,963 students) is larger than Lynn (3,501 students) with more enrolled students.
- Lynn ($18,837) has higher amount of financial aid than Polk State ($3,928).
- Lynn's graduation rate (53%) is higher than Polk State (34%).
